Output 08b97fcdb7a5d1cc5514b0ee913cc7ef7be68a5f6bdfbfead553e7938dc1717e:0

value
19896689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463c31078f5d0999130299deb53278f90e2cde06 OP_EQUAL
address
MEJXe3Bxd4hFsSNZfrD5MfN6t7uKCe9QV7
transaction
08b97fcdb7a5d1cc5514b0ee913cc7ef7be68a5f6bdfbfead553e7938dc1717e
spent
true